The Allure of Cult TV

Cult TV shows have a special aura. Unlike typical television fare, these shows develop fiercely loyal fan bases, often transcending geographical boundaries. Iconic lines, memorable episodes, and groundbreaking characters define them, creating a shared language among fans. Refreshed versions of these epic series seek to balance nostalgia with modern storytelling.

Storylines: From the Familiar to the Bold

Reboots often expand upon original storylines or delve into previously unexplored arcs. With today's viewers expecting nuanced narratives, plotlines have evolved. For example, 'Battlestar Galactica’s' reimagining took bold steps in story complexity, exploring ethics, politics, and human survival, weaving a thrilling tale that engaged deeper emotional responses.
